About
Mink Mussel Creek is an Australian psychedelic rock band originating from Perth, known for their energetic fusion of acid rock and stoner rock elements. The group features a talented lineup, including Nick Allbrook (vocals, bass), Joseph Ryan (guitar), and Kevin Parker (drums, guitar), who later gained fame with Tame Impala. Mink Mussel Creek's sound is characterized by its expansive sonic landscapes and a neo-psychedelic approach, making them a standout act in the Australian music scene. Their exploration of psychedelic textures and improvisational flair has drawn comparisons to the 60s and 70s rock era, while maintaining a modern edge.
How to Sound Like Mink Mussel Creek
Mink Mussel Creek's sonic character is defined by its vibrant and swirling psychedelic tones, which can be both aggressive and ethereal. Their music often features rich, layered guitar effects paired with a dynamic rhythm section, creating an immersive listening experience. The use of the Electro-Harmonix Superego Synth Engine by Joseph Ryan contributes to the band's otherworldly soundscapes, while Nick Allbrook's bass lines through an Ampeg SVT-CL Classic provide a powerful foundation. Kevin Parker's involvement with the MXR M169 Carbon Copy adds lush, analog delay effects, enhancing the dreamy yet intense atmosphere of their performances. This blend of vibrant guitar tones, hypnotic rhythms, and psychedelic effects captures the essence of Mink Mussel Creek's exploratory and transcendent musical journey.
